The biggest twist may be 1000mAh but there is the SPINNER which is 1300mAh. At 25 bucks,I find it a great unit. There is also a 650mAh vv pass through with a digital readout that goes from 3 to 6 volts.Also 25 bucks. I have 2 of those as well,and I love them. Not quite as fancy as the Provari,but it does the same job for a fraction of the price.

Once again, I am late to a thread. But my two cents (which costs more than a penny for my thoughts), if your device is doing what you want it to do, then you are doing just fine. Some vapers aren't satisfied with a Twist and NEED TO HAVE A PROVARI NEEEYOOOW.

But then again, MANY, MANY, MANY people are satisfied with their Twists, their eGos, etc. Me, included. But then again, you're not me, I'm not you, so our opinions may vary.

I'm of this philosophy: Just because you CAN crank your device up to 5.0+ volts, doesn't necessarily mean you SHOULD.

A lot of it depends on juice. I vape 80 pg/20 vg highly sweet juices, so cranking it up higher than 3.8 makes it taste funknasty.
